Hi Caprickhan, welcome to the forums .

Once you've selected the hardware item you wish to update the drivers for, did you right click > "update driver software" > "Browse my computer for driver software"? That's the easiest way of updating drivers manually if you've got the source files, although may drivers provide some form of installer.

Which drivers are you trying to update and we may be able to provide some more specific help .
